Mexico - Biochemical Oxygen Demand in Inflow of Urban Wastewater After Plant Treatment

Since 2014, Mexico Biochemical Oxygen Demand in Inflow of Urban Wastewater After Plant Treatment increased 4.4% year on year. At 2,618.11 Thousand Kilograms of O2 Per Day in 2019, the country was ranked number 1 comparing other countries in Biochemical Oxygen Demand in Inflow of Urban Wastewater After Plant Treatment. Netherlands, Austria and Greece respectively ranked number 2, 3 and 4 in this ranking. Mexico recorded the best 5 years average growth at +4.4% per year, while Finland recorded the worst performance at -2.4% per year.
